AaptParser
public
class
AaptParser
extends Object
java.lang.Object | |
↳ | com.android.tradefed.util.AaptParser |
Lớp trích xuất thông tin từ tệp APK bằng cách phân tích cú pháp đầu ra của "aapt dump badging".
aapt phải nằm trên PATH
Tóm tắt
Phương thức công khai | |
---|---|
String
|
getLabel()
|
|
getNativeCode()
|
String
|
getPackageName()
|
int
|
getSdkVersion()
|
int
|
getTargetSdkVersion()
|
String
|
getVersionCode()
|
String
|
getVersionName()
|
boolean
|
isRequestingLegacyStorage()
Kiểm tra xem ứng dụng có đang yêu cầu bộ nhớ cũ hay không. |
boolean
|
isUsingPermissionManageExternalStorage()
|
static
AaptParser
|
parse(File apkFile, AaptParser.AaptVersion aaptVersion)
Phân tích cú pháp thông tin từ tệp apk. |
static
AaptParser
|
parse(File apkFile)
Phân tích cú pháp thông tin từ tệp apk. |
Phương thức công khai
getLabel
public String getLabel ()
Giá trị trả về | |
---|---|
String |
getNativeCode
publicgetNativeCode ()
Giá trị trả về | |
---|---|
|
getPackageName
public String getPackageName ()
Giá trị trả về | |
---|---|
String |
getSdkVersion
public int getSdkVersion ()
Giá trị trả về | |
---|---|
int |
getTargetSdkVersion
public int getTargetSdkVersion ()
Giá trị trả về | |
---|---|
int |
getVersionCode
public String getVersionCode ()
Giá trị trả về | |
---|---|
String |
getVersionName
public String getVersionName ()
Giá trị trả về | |
---|---|
String |
isRequestingLegacyStorage
public boolean isRequestingLegacyStorage ()
Kiểm tra xem ứng dụng có đang yêu cầu bộ nhớ cũ hay không.
Giá trị trả về | |
---|---|
boolean |
boolean trả về true nếu requestLegacyExternalStorage là true trong AndroidManifest.xml |
isUsingPermissionManageExternalStorage
public boolean isUsingPermissionManageExternalStorage ()
Giá trị trả về | |
---|---|
boolean |
phân tích cú pháp
public static AaptParser parse (File apkFile, AaptParser.AaptVersion aaptVersion)
Phân tích cú pháp thông tin từ tệp apk.
Tham số | |
---|---|
apkFile |
File : tệp apk |
aaptVersion |
AaptParser.AaptVersion : phiên bản aapt |
Giá trị trả về | |
---|---|
AaptParser |
AaptParser hoặc null nếu không trích xuất được thông tin |
phân tích cú pháp
public static AaptParser parse (File apkFile)
Phân tích cú pháp thông tin từ tệp apk.
Tham số | |
---|---|
apkFile |
File : tệp apk |
Giá trị trả về | |
---|---|
AaptParser |
AaptParser hoặc null nếu không trích xuất được thông tin |